Output 901879b148a6100d76c59bf5c46cb4ccfa238bf3c6cd38d7a0a5c1e75b82cafe:4

value
94598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efd899f39f518e79e23437c8cc4b5580bc649048 OP_EQUAL
address
3PZCu7pu7L5tXT8T3ztL6ym8nuHUC25uWD
transaction
901879b148a6100d76c59bf5c46cb4ccfa238bf3c6cd38d7a0a5c1e75b82cafe
confirmations
294071
spent
true